How to Permanently Sim Unlock Tracfone Devices

All Tracfone (and its subsidiaries) devices, both GSM and CDMA, can now be unlocked through UnlockBase. 

The process is fairly easy. Here’s how: 

1. Dial #TFUNLOCK# (#83865625#) to open the Unlock Code menu

2. The device will ask for 2 Unlock Codes: In the first field, please enter the MCK/DEFREEZE Code. In the second field, please enter either the SPCK code OR (in case you did not receive an SPCK code), the NCK/NETWORK code.

3. Your device will show a “Device Unlocked“ message and may reboot.

4. That’s it – Your device is now successfully unlocked and ready to use with any GSM carrier worldwide!

How to Know If You’re Using Tracfone GSM or CDMA Phone

There are two types of Tracfone devices, CDMA and GSM. It is important to know that an unlocked CDMA phone will only work with CDMA carriers, and an unlocked GSM phone will only work with GSM carriers. 

If you are planning to switch carriers, please make sure that your phone is compatible with the type of network your new carrier is servicing. 

Although most carriers in the USA are GSM, many carriers such as Verizon, Sprint, and US Cellular still use CDMA. On the other hand, the more commonly known carriers that are GSM are T-Mobile and AT&T. 

If you are unsure what type of Tracfone you own, here is an easy way how: 

For older Tracfone device

• If your phone model ends with a “G”, then it means you are using a phone compatible with a GSM carrier. 

• If your phone model ends with either a “C” it means you are using a phone compatible with a CDMA network. 

For new Tracfone device

• If your phone model ends with “VL” it means it’s using the Verizon-LTE network. 

• Some GSM phones from Tracfone use “AL” or “BL” which means they are either using AT&T LTE or T-Mobile LTE. There are also “DL”and “TL” models both of these are GSM as well.
